Efektivitas Penggunaan Linktree dalam Mendukung Informasi Pengusulan Tugas Belajar bagi Aparatur Sipil Negeri di Kabupaten Sumbawa Barat

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engevaluasi efektivitas penggunaan Linktree dalam mendukung penyediaan informasi pengusulan tugas belajar bagi Aparatur Sipil Negara (ASN) di Kabupaten Sumbawa Barat. Penelitian menggunakan pendekatan metode campuran dengan mengintegrasikan analisis kuantitatif melalui kuesioner dan analisis kualitatif melalui wawancara serta observasi langsung.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a penggunaan Linktree meningkatkan efisiensi akses informasi hingga 75%, dengan pengaruh sebesar 74,5% terhadap efektivitas layanan berdasarkan uji regresi linear sederhana. Responden melaporkan peningkatan kepuasan dan kemudahan akses informasi, meskipun terdapat tantangan dalam pembaruan informasi dan keterbatasan konektivitas internet. Penelitian ini menyimpulkan bahwa Linktree adalah platform yang efektif untuk mendukung transformasi digital layanan publik, dengan rekomendasi untuk peningkatan infrastruktur digital, pembaruan konten yang rutin, dan pelatihan literasi digital bagi pengguna.
Effectiveness of Linktree in Supporting Study Assignment Information for Civil Servants in West Sumbawa Regency
Abstract
This study aims to evaluate the effectiveness of Linktree in supporting the provision of study assignment information for Civil Servants in West Sumbawa Regency. A mixed-method approach was employed, integrating quantitative analysis through questionnaires and qualitative analysis through interviews and direct observations. The findings revealed that Linktree increased information access efficiency by 75%, with a 74.5% impact on service effectiveness based on simple linear regression analysis. Respondents reported enhanced satisfaction and ease of access, although challenges were identified in updating information and limited internet connectivity. The study concludes that Linktree is an effective platform to support the digital transformation of public services, with recommendations for improving digital infrastructure, regular content updates, and user digital literacy training.
